At 4:30 pm today, Saturday, 3 confrontations will be completed within the framework of the twenty-fifth round of the Upper Egypt group in the second division league, between Kima Aswan with the youth of Qena, Petroleum Assiut with Malawi, and La Vienna with the Tamiya Youth Center.
Before the start of this round, the Laviena team, the leader of the Upper Egypt group standings with 53 points, will host the Tamiya Youth Center team, the thirteenth-place team, with 19 points. The third-placed Assiut Petroleum team, with 47 points, meets the Malwa team, which is in the fourteenth place, with 18 points. The Petroleum team seeks to stop the bleeding of points after the loss from El Gouna in the last match and the exit from the Egypt Cup at the hands of Al-Masry, and hopes to return to the path of victories. In order to continue the pressure on the Lavienna and El Gouna teams in an attempt to qualify for the Premier League next season, at a time when the Malawi team seeks to come up with a positive result in order to improve its position in the standings.
